Variational inequality matlab software

Such reduction allows one to solve the variational inequalities with the help of the matlab software. Solving variational inequalities with stochastic mirror. An approach for solving fuzzy implicit variational. A neural network method for solving a system of linear. Such reduction allows one to solve the variational inequalities with the help of the matlab software package. Rm, the parameterized variational inequality can be represented as fx,y. In this paper the variational inequality theory and numerical method on contact problems are briefly described first, and then the structure of its application software is outlined.

In addition, we propose a modified version of our algorithm that. Qpecgen, a matlab generator for mathematical programs with. Further, the estimation of the exponential convergence rates of the neural networks is investigated. Lectures on numerical methods for nonlinear variational. The technique, which is independent of any merit function, is applicable for pseudomonotone problems. Adaptive finite element methods for variational inequalities. On optimization problems with variational inequality. This paper summarizes basic facts in both nite and in nite dimensional optimization and for variational inequalities. The majority of firstorder methods for largescale convexconcave saddle point problems and variational inequalities with monotone operators are proximal algorithms. A matlab collection of variational inequality problems citeseerx. The avi is a special case of a variational inequality vi, where the function \f\ is affine. In this paper, we consider a class of fuzzy implicit variational inequalities with linear membership functions. Finally, this research presents a matlab implementation for solving parametric monotone linear complementarity problems.

We propose a projectiontype method with inertial terms and give weak convergence analysis under appropriate conditions. Variational inequalities and on their approximation 1 introduction an important and very useful class of nonlinear problems arising from 1 mechanics, physics etc. We mainly consider the following two types of variational inequalities, namely 1. Optimization and variational inequalities basic statements. A qpec is a quadratic mpec, that is an optimization problem whose objective function is quadratic, firstlevel constraints are linear, and secondlevel equilibrium constraints are given by a parametric affine variational inequality or one of its. A matlab software for semidefinite programming with bound constraints version 1. Numeric or string inputs a and b must either be the same size or have sizes that are compatible for example, a is an mbyn matrix and b is a scalar or 1byn row vector. A projection descent method for solving variational. Fourier and isye, georgia institute of technology in this paper we consider iterative methods for stochastic vari. A descent algorithm for solving variational inequality. Decomposition techniques for bilinear saddle point.

Further, we study the convergence analysis of our proposed iterative method. Optimization and variational inequalities basic statements and constructions bernd kummer. Matlab software for speech synthesis through eigenvoices. The cost function is assumed to be nonlipschitz and monotone. Mupad notebooks will be removed in a future release. Include constraints that can be expressed as matrix inequalities or equalities. Citeseerx qpecgen, a matlab generator for mathematical.

For solving of these inequalities, we apply the reduction to the linear complementarity problem. How to plot inequality learn more about plot, 3d plots. The descent direction is derived from the wellknown alternating directions method. A variational inequality approach to compute generalized nash. The solver, called tresnei, is adequate for zero and smallresidual problems and handles the solution of nonlinear systems of equalities and inequalities. This is the variational bayesian inference method for gaussian mixture model. Finally the numerical results of its application to gravity dam with vertical gaps are given out. Qpecgen, a matlab generator for mathematical programs. I need a good solver for vis that i can link with matlab. Complementarity constraint formulation of variational inequality any parameterized variational inequality pvi can be represented as a problem with complementarity constraints. Nonlinear equality and inequality constraints matlab. Variational inequality algorithms resolve the vi problem into, typically, a series of optimization problems. Hence, usually, variational inequality algorithms proceed to the equilibrium iteratively and progressively via some procedure. Include nonlinear constraints by writing a function that computes both equality and inequality constraint values.

Variational bayes method mean field for gmm can auto determine the number of components. A neural network method for solving a system of linear variational inequalities. We also give a numerical example to illustrate the validity of our approach. Rbau01jypn ydepartment of pure and applied mathematics, university of padua, italy. Matlab software for assessing the number of clusters in spectral clustering. Qpecgen, a matlab generator for mathematical programs with quadratic objectives and a ne variational inequality constraints houyuan jiang and daniel ralph the university of melbourne department of mathematics and statistics parkville, vic. By the commonly emulation mode of matlab software, we have the following computational results for this problem, which are listed in table 1. Solving of variational inequalities by reducing to the. The purpose of this paper is to consider a class of mathematical programs with fuzzy implicit variational inequality constraints in finite dimension real spaces. Mathworks is the leading developer of mathematical computing software for engineers and scientists. How to write constraints for individual components. We have used lsqr method, combined by a convenient preconditioner a variant of incomplete lu. We propose a new projection algorithm for solving the variational inequality.

This paper is devoted to a class of optimization problems that contain variational inequality or nonlinear complementarity constraints. On solutions of variational inequality problems via. In order to create a plot of a freefem simulation in matlab or octave two steps are necessary the mesh, the finite element space connectivity and the simulation data must be exported into files. Decomposition techniques for bilinear saddle point problems and variational inequalities with affine monotone operators. To avoid repetition, we assume you are already familiar with the theory and notation for vi models. I have a code but after 6 iteractions matlab blocks and gives me this warning. Access documentation, examples, and common questions asked in the community. Online support for matlab, simulink, and other mathworks products. The set of solutions of variational inequality problem is denoted by.

Variational inequality theory was introduced by hartman and stampacchia 1966 as a tool for the study of partial di erential equations with applications principally drawn from mechanics. A descent method for structured monotone variational. Theory and applications in finance by chensong zhang dissertation submitted to the faculty of the graduate school of the university of maryland, college park in partial ful. In mathematics, a variational inequality is an inequality involving a functional, which has to be solved for all possible values of a given variable, belonging usually to a convex set.

Variational inequality function on matlab matlab answers. Matlab live scripts support most mupad functionality, though there are some differences. Choose a web site to get translated content where available and see local events and offers. In addition, partially new results concerning methods and stability are included. A new double projection algorithm for variational inequalities core. Unlike the em algorithm maximum likelihood estimation, it can automatically determine the number of. Quasi variational inequalities are a generalization of the variational inequality model. The variational bayesian em algorithm for incomplete data. A variational inequality approach to compute generalized.

This example shows how to solve an optimization problem containing nonlinear constraints. An approach for solving fuzzy implicit variational inequalities with. Solving implicit mathematical programs with fuzzy variational inequality constraints based on the method of centres with entropic regularization article in fuzzy optimization and decision making. The matlab files implementing several variational inequality problems and nonlinear complementarity problems arising from the literature are given. For the details of the software, please check the following papers. Matlab subprograms based on the stiffness matrix method were developed. Numerical methods for fractional blackscholes equations and variational inequalities governing option pricing wen chen this thesis is presented for the degree of doctor of philosophy of the university of. Problems of this kind arise, for example, in game theory, bilevel programming, and the design of networks subject to equilibrium conditions. A qpec is a quadratic mpec, that is an optimization problem whose objective function is quadratic, firstlevel constraints are linear, and secondlevel equilibrium constraints are given by a parametric affine variational inequality or one of its specialisations. Im dealing with a variety of variational inequality, but all of them are differentiable. By the separation property of hyperplane, our method is proved to be globally convergent under very mild assumptions. A library of quasi variational inequality test problems quasi variational inequalities qvis are a well established and important modelling tool with several applications in different fields.

In chapter 3, we describe a relaxed projection method, and a descent method for solving variational inequalities with some examples. Largescale computing for complementarity and variational. How to include general inequality and equality constraints. In general, i like to familiar with a variety of software for various problems. Povcalnet is an online tool hosted by the world bank which calculates various poverty and income inequality measures underlying wbs wdi world development indicators. Mathworks is the leading developer of mathematical computing software for engineers. Projection based algorithms for variational inequalities. Problems of this kind arise, for example, in game theory, bil. Warning message unable to write to excel format im solving a problem with variational inequality. Linear matrix inequalities lmis and lmi techniques have emerged as powerful design tools in areas ranging from control engineering to system identification and structural design. Variational bayesian inference for gaussian mixture model. Extension of the pathavi scheme to solving nonlinear variational inequalities is proposed.

By using the tolerance approach, we show that solving such problems can be. I have path but when the dimension increase, it fails to solve the problem. If you are solving a pde system, you could discretize once to get it into dae or ode form to put it into apmonitor modeling language. Such variational inequalities were in nitedimensional rather than nitedimensional as we will be studying here. Linear matrix inequalities in system and control theory. Jul, 2006 this paper is devoted to a class of optimization problems that contain variational inequality or nonlinear complementarity constraints. In fact, a globalization technique on the basis of the hyperplane projection method is applied to the bfgs method. You really dont want to find all points for which the inequality holds, as this are infinitely many in your case. At the url the matlab m script and mfunction files. In this paper, we propose a globally convergent bfgs method to solve variational inequality problems vips. This package implements solution algorithms for solving finitedimensional variational inequality vi problems. The variational inequality method on contact problems and its. In this section, we present a mathematical formulation of qvi, give an.

Finally, we give application and a numerical example to. Algebra software, matlab second order differential equation solution, explain the substitution method in algebra, free plotting points worksheets, how is doing operations adding, subtracting, multiplying, and dividing with rational expressions similar to or different from doing operations with fractions. Qpecgen, a matlab generator for mathematical programs with quadratic objectives and affine variational inequality constraints. Variational gaussian mixture model for matlab vbgmm this toolbox implements variational inference for gaussian mixture models vbgmm as per chapter 10 of pattern recognition and machine learning by c. We propose and analyze an inertial iterative algorithm to approximate a common solution of generalized equilibrium problem, variational inequality problem, and fixed point problem in the framework of a 2uniformly convex and uniformly smooth real banach space. In this paper a structural analysis toolbox based on stiffness matrix method is presented for teaching structural analysis in the university. Its aim is to cover as many countries and years as possible starting from 1980. A has m randomly generated bounded inequality constraints. Jul 02, 2019 variational inequality function on matlab. Learn more about variational inequality, optimization. A globally convergent bfgs method for pseudomonotone. A version of the method of centres with entropic regularization techniques, only used a quasinewton line search using matlab software is required in our.

Numerical methods for fractional blackscholes equations. The first problem involving a variational inequality was the signorini problem, posed by antonio signorini in 1959 and solved by gaetano fichera in 1963, according to the references antman 1983, pp. We propose a class of new double projection algorithms for solving variational inequality problem, which can be viewed as a framework of the method of solodov and svaiter by adopting a class of new hyperplanes. We study the variational inequalities closely connected with the linear separation problem of the convex polyhedrain the euclidean space. Fixed point algorithm for solving nonmonotone variational. Federica tintiy september 2003 abstract in order to give a uniform basis for testing several algorithms, in. In this paper, we transmute the solution for a new system of linear variational inequalities to an equilibrium point of neural networks, and by using analytic technique, some sufficient conditions are presented. A fortran 90 software designed to solve large scale variational inequality problems using the generalisation of the inexact newton method applied to a semismooth nonlinear system description. Weak convergence for variational inequalities with. Weak convergence of inertial iterative method for solving variational inequalities is the focus of this paper. The projection on a convex satisfy clearly \\forall v \in \mathcalc, \quad u v, u \tildef \leq 0\, and after expanding, we get the classical inequality. Optimize when only one constraint of a set is necessary.

Development of matrix method based structural analysis. Trial software variational inequality function on matlab. This article presents a descent method for solving monotone variational inequalities with separate structures. By using the tolerance approach and the fuzzy set theory, we also show that solving the fuzzy mathematical program problem with fuzzy implicit variational inequality constraints is equivalent to solving a fuzzy implicit. An application of the descent framework to a game theory problem leads to an algorithm for solving box constrained variational inequalities. We describe a technique for generating a special class, called qpec, of mathematical programs with equilibrium constraints, mpec. A matlab collection of variational inequality problems. Some test results are performed and compared with relevant methods in the literature to show the. The mathematical theory of variational inequalities was initially developed to deal with equilibrium problems, precisely the signorini problem. It shows that both of the numerical method and its software are valid. Operands, specified as scalars, vectors, matrices, or multidimensional arrays. The optimal step size along the descent direction also improves the efficiency of the new method. The files must be imported into the matlab octave workspace.

Jun 18, 2018 a variational inequality approach to compute. On solutions of variational inequality problems via iterative. Contribute to all umassvi solver development by creating an account on github. The software is available as a web service for commercial or academic use. Display areas where inequalities are fulfilled mupad. By using the tolerance approach, we show that solving such problems can be reduced to semiin. Part of the code is based on a barebone matlab implementation by mo chen. Generalized nash games and variational inequalities, \textitoper. New double projection algorithm for solving variational. Mathworks is the leading developer of mathematical computing software for. The objective is to make an interface between academic and commercial purpose software. A new iterate is obtained by searching the optimal step size along a new descent direction which is obtained by the linear combination of two descent directions. A version of the method of centres with entropic regularization techniques, only using a quasinewton line search implemented in matlab. Polyak, introduction to optimization, optimization software inc.

A descent algorithm for solving variational inequality problems zahira kebaili and a. Under suitable conditions, the global convergence of the proposed method is studied. We conclude the section with a short discussion of the general emp syntax for bilevel programs. In this paper, we propose a descent direction method for solving variational inequalities. Speci cally, at each iteration of a vi algorithm, one encounters a linearized or relaxed substitute of the orig. Strong convergence of an inertial iterative algorithm for. A variational inequality approach to compute generalized nash equilibrium. Tresnei, a matlab trustregion solver for systems of nonlinear equalities and inequalities the matlab implementation of a trustregion gaussnewton method for boundconstrained nonlinear leastsquares problems is presented. Based on your location, we recommend that you select.

285 924 575 1050 1220 190 1274 1323 1443 425 982 1414 864 1464 1303 790 461 1028 1153 133 671 792 626 802 896 1056 1272 1001 530 284 1046